Broken Keys

A broken key is among of the most frustrating things to happen. It can leave you feeling lost and render your car unusable until you receive an replacement.

Fortunately, there are several options to solve this issue. The most efficient method is to call an expert locksmith. They can assist you in solving this issue in a quick manner, meaning you don't have to go through the trouble of replacing the entire key.

They can also provide a new key. They can do it for only a fraction of the cost of an entirely new key.

The first thing you should do is to take the broken key out of the ignition or door lock. This is essential as it will stop further damage to the lock and the cylinder.

An extractor is a tool that can be used to do this. These tools come with a hook at the end that can be inserted into the lock cylinder and can be turned towards the teeth of the key that is broken to remove it.

A wedge and pliers are a different method to remove a key from an ignition lock or lock. This method has been in use for many years and is still extremely popular.

These tools are sold at hardware stores and most home improvement stores. These tools are flat and thin with sharp edges. They can be wedged into the lockcylinder. To get the fragments out you can apply pressure to the edge.

When a key breaks in the door or ignition it could be caused by a variety of causes. It could be stuck, rusted, or have frozen parts inside it.

If it's a simple instance of a broken blade you might be able to repair it on your own. If the blade has been damaged and the lock has become jammed, you will need to call an expert.

Depending on the kind of key, there are various ways to replace it. You can either get a locksmith to replace the key or create an exact copy. It should be easy to duplicate the standard key for a car or house. If the key is equipped with a transponder chip this can be more difficult. This may require a particular programming service that is carried out by experts.

There are a few options that you can try to replace keys lost or misplaced. However, first, you need to know your car's key type.

Traditional: If you've got a traditional key that doesn't come with buttons or chips it's likely that you can replace it at the local locksmith shop at a cost-effective price. They are likely to be able to create the new key right away.

Modern Modern cars keys replacement come with transponder keys. This key has a computer chip that connects your car to the key. The code is sent to the engine in your car and allows you to open the doors, turn on the engine on, and then drive away.

They are more secure than their predecessors, but are more expensive to replace. In most instances, it will cost you between $200 and $250 to have your car towed to the dealership and get a new key made.

Certain manufacturers will also require that you present proof of ownership, which can increase the cost of replacing the item.

In addition, the majority of standard car insurance policies will not cover lost or stolen keys to your car It is therefore important to review your policy before you think about buying a new keys.

Lost Key Fobs

A key fob will help you lock and unlock your car, but it also doubles as a deterrent to theft. Some of them even come with the option of summoning that lets you free your vehicle of the tight spot with just a push of an button.

Automakers have developed smart keys that can do more than lock and unlock your vehicle. They can also start the engine and some models let you park your car.

These smart key fobs are more complicated than regular locks and keys, which means that they could be costly to replace. Some are laser-cut, car key replacement cost and require special equipment and programming machines which only dealers can make use of.

Certain vehicles come with transponder chips that have to be programmed by the dealership before it works. This is a costly part of the replacement process. It can cost anywhere between $200 and $500.

It can take up to an hour depending on the type of key. You'll want to bring proof of ownership with you to the shop to ensure your car can be properly coded.
